Alex Murdaugh Denied New Trial in Murder Case

Judge Rules Insufficient Evidence of Jury Tampering by Court Clerk

  • Alex Murdaugh, a former South Carolina attorney, has been denied a new trial in the murder case of his wife and son.
  • Murdaugh's defense team had accused court clerk Rebecca Hill of tampering with the jury, but the judge ruled that there was not enough evidence to support these claims.
  • Hill has been accused of making 'fleeting and foolish' comments during the trial and of writing a book about the case to increase her sales.
  • One juror testified that Hill's comments influenced their decision, but the majority of the jurors stated that their verdict was not affected by Hill.
  • Murdaugh's defense team plans to appeal the decision.
